About Extended Stay America Suites Cincinnati Blue Ash Reed Hartma
Comfortable Accommodations Extended Stay America Suites - Cincinnati - Blue Ash - Reed Hartman in Blue Ash offers family rooms with air-conditioning, private bathrooms, and fully equipped kitchens. Each room includes a dining area, work desk, and free WiFi. Convenient Facilities Guests enjoy a elevator, 24-hour front desk, picnic area, and free on-site private parking. Additional amenities include a tea and coffee maker, hairdryer, dining table, sofa bed, refrigerator, work desk, seating area, free toiletries, microwave, dishwasher, shower, TV, sofa, dining area, kitchenware, stovetop, and toaster. Prime Location Located 11 mi from Kings Island, 11 mi from Cincinnati Observatory Center, and 13 mi from Cincinnati Zoo and Botanical Garden. Nearby attractions include Cincinnati Museum Center (16 mi) and Great American Ball Park (17 mi). Guests appreciate the convenient location, attentive staff, and excellent value for money.

The cost was affordable but after the experience, it turned out to be a poor value. I had no hot water in the shower. The breakfast was limited to coffee and cereal options. Customer service was subpar. After advising the front desk that my shower did not have hot water on the first day there , the manager did not make an effort to correct the issue. I advised the manager again the next day. She seemed surprised, as if she was unaware of the problem. She promised to have the plumber investigate the issue (again) as a first option and change rooms as a second option if the problem could not be fixed. She never responded with an update and she did not advise her staff. After 2 days and 3 nights, I checked out early. I advised the night auditor before hand so there would be no confusion when I check out. I requested a refund for the last day that was not used. The attendant assured me that there be no problem but he had to obtain the manager’s approval. Promised to forward the information to the supervisor the next day. Again, no response. I called to follow up but was told the manager was not available. It has been 3 days and each time I’ve been put off with the same excuse.
